Title :
Efficient permutation criterion for obtaining minimal trellis of a block code

Abstract :
To reduce the decoding complexity efficiently when using a trellis, a criterion is introduced, which can indicate at each stage of decoding whether or not the appropriate permutations on columns of the generator or parity-check matrix of the code are needed to obtain the minimal trellis in terms of its complexity. This criterion can also be used as a guide for finding a way to carry out column permutations more efficiently, as is shown in an example
